What are some common challenges faced by Remote Python & SQL Developers, and how can they be addressed?

Remote Python & SQL Developers often face challenges such as effective communication with distributed teams, managing overlapping project priorities, and ensuring data security when accessing databases remotely. To address these, it's crucial to establish clear communication routines (like daily stand-ups), use collaborative tools (such as Slack or Jira), and strictly follow company protocols for secure database access. Proactively seeking feedback and documenting code also help maintain project alignment and code quality within a remote environment.

What is a Remote Python SQL job?

A Remote Python SQL job involves working with databases and backend systems using the Python programming language and SQL (Structured Query Language) while working from a location outside of a traditional office. Professionals in this role typically write code to query, manipulate, and analyze data stored in databases, automate data workflows, and build data-driven applications. Remote arrangements allow these tasks to be completed from anywhere with a stable internet connection, offering flexibility while still requiring strong technical and communication skills.

Remote Python Sql roles focus on programming, data extraction, and database management, while Remote Data Analyst positions emphasize interpreting data, creating reports, and visualizations. Both roles often require SQL skills and can be found in similar industries, but they serve different functions within data teams.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Remote Python SQL Developer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Remote Python SQL Developer, you need strong proficiency in Python programming and SQL database management, typically backed by a degree in computer science or related experience. Familiarity with tools like PostgreSQL, MySQL, version control systems (e.g., Git), and cloud platforms is commonly required, along with any relevant certifications. Excellent problem-solving, self-motivation, and effective remote communication skills set standout professionals apart in this role. These skills are crucial for efficiently building and maintaining robust data-driven applications while collaborating seamlessly in distributed teams.

Job description

Location: Huntsville, AL or Washington, DC
Required Clearance: TS/SCI Eligible
Required Education: HS/GED
Required Experience: Minimum of 4 years of experience in data science, analytics engineering, ML, operations, or AI

Hybrid: 3 days of onsite/ 2 days remote 

Position Description

This position supports the Golden Dome Supply Chain Enterprise program by executing analytics workflows, data ingestion pipelines, and machine learning model operations within the operations and implementation branch. The engineer works under the technical direction of an Exiger AI Solution Engineer lead, executing ETL processes, analytics production runs, and pipeline maintenance that feed the program's Red Team and Blue Team analytic constructs

Responsibilities

•    Execute ETL pipelines for supply chain data ingestion including customer technical data packages, transformation, and loading into the Exiger environment
•    Run and monitor ML model inference jobs, flagging anomalies and performance degradation to the lead
•    Build and maintain data pipeline automation using Python, SQL, and orchestration frameworks (Airflow, Spark, dbt, or equivalent)
•    Produce analytics outputs that feed Red Team vulnerability assessments and Blue Team mitigation planning
•    Participate in data quality validation workflows and contribute to confidence scoring documentation
•    Support iterative analytics configuration releases based on Government feedback cycles
•    Maintain pipeline documentation, run logs, and provenance records per program governance standards


Required Qualifications

•    Minimum 4 years of experience in data science, analytics engineering, ML operations, or AI
•    Proficiency in Python, SQL, and data pipeline tools (Airflow, Spark, pandas, dbt, or equivalent); working knowledge of relational and cloud data platforms (PostgreSQL, Snowflake, or equivalent)
•    Experience with ETL/ELT processes, data transformation, and analytics production workflows across structured and semi-structured data sources
•    Familiarity with ML model deployment and monitoring in cloud environments (AWS, Azure, or equivalent)
•    Experience working under technical oversight in an integrated government delivery team
•    Strong documentation practices and ability to maintain auditable process records
